Rhodium-Catalyzed Asymmetric [2 + 2 + 2] Cycloaddition of Unsymmetrical α,ω-Diynes with Acenaphthylene

It has been established that a cationic rhodium­(I)/(R)-BINAP complex catalyzes the asymmetric [2 + 2 + 2] cycloaddition of unsymmetrical α,ω-diynes with acenaphthylene at room temperature to give the corresponding chiral multicyclic compounds with high yields and ee values. Interestingly, enantioselectivity highly depended on the structures of α,ω-diynes used. The structural requirements of α,ω-diynes for high enantioselectivity were opposite to those in our previously reported cationic rhodium­(I)/(R)-Difluorphos complex-catalyzed asymmetric [2 + 2 + 2] cycloaddition of α,ω-diynes with indene.
